The chairman of the PNV GBB, Joseba Egibar, will not run as a parliamentarian on the PNV lists for the next regional elections in 2024, and Markel Olano, former deputy general of Gipuzkoa, will join the Jeltzale candidacy , as EITB has learned. In addition, the Guipuzcoan will repeat as a candidate for the presidency of the Basque Parliament Bakartxo Tejeria.
According to the same sources, Egibar has decided not to appear again as a candidate in the elections for the Basque Chamber. The chairman of the GBB and member of the National Board of the PNV has been a Basque parliamentarian since 1990 and spokesperson for Jeltzale in the Basque Chamber since 1998.
The PNV’s Euskadi Buru Batzar will meet this afternoon in Sabin Etxea to determine the lists to be presented in the next elections for the Basque Parliament. According to the party’s statutes, it is up to the leadership to propose 60% of the lists.
As the internal process of preparing candidates progresses, the PNV will decide who will lead the lists for Álava, Bizkaia and Gipuzkoa.
